posticon Making of my TRIBLADE Bat-boomerang


Some photos of the steps I had to take to finish the Batarang, to make the mold I used cardboard and fixed it on a surface using tape, and then sealed the seams with glue, and then fixed the Batarang to the surface with glue and then made a simple silicone mold. This is an older project, I posted it to motivate people to do their own Batarangs

First step was to make a drawing and then cut out the wood and form the prototype

After that I made another drawing and a second prototype Batarang

Then I painted the wood and prepared the mold.

The mold came out nice and I started the casting, here is a photo of an Aluminum cold-cast version, hand polished

Thanks Doh2, its a cold cast, its urethane resin filled with lots of very fine aluminum powder, therefor it looks like aluminum but in fact its also urethane resin in there! This technique is also used by museums to cold cast objects of metal, like bronze or gold objects. The Batarang cast then had to be polished by hand with different kind of very fine sandpapers and in the end polished with a polishing paste.
